Start with the geography your firm actually serves
Clarksburg is recorded as a municipality in Harrison County, West Virginia. The 2020–2024 ACS five-year estimate records 15,549 residents, with a margin of error of 31. That figure describes the city population; it does not establish legal demand, search volume, competition, review potential or revenue. A reputation plan should therefore distinguish Clarksburg from Harrison County and from any wider service area your firm chooses to evaluate. It should also distinguish households and individuals when the firm reviews its own client records.
